CryptoAPIs MCP Simulate
MCP server for dry-run EVM transaction simulation via Crypto APIs
@cryptoapis-io/mcp-simulate
MCP server for Crypto APIs Simulate product. Dry-run EVM transactions to preview results without broadcasting.
API Version: Compatible with Crypto APIs version 2024-12-12
Features
- Simulate EVM transactions before broadcasting
- Preview transaction results, gas usage, and state changes
- Supports all EVM-compatible blockchains (Ethereum, Ethereum Classic, BSC, Polygon, Avalanche (C-Chain), Arbitrum, Base, Optimism, Tron)

Available Tools
simulate_evm
Simulate an EVM transaction (dry run).
| Parameter | Description |
|---|---|
blockchain | Target blockchain (ethereum, binance-smart-chain, polygon, etc.) |
network | Network (mainnet, sepolia, testnet, etc.) |
fromAddress | Sender address |
toAddress | Recipient address |
value | Amount to send (in native coin) |
data | Contract call data (hex) |
gasLimit | Gas limit |
gasPrice | Gas price |

HTTP API Key Modes
When using HTTP transport, the server supports two API key modes:
- With
--api-key: The key is used for all requests.x-api-keyrequest headers are ignored. - Without
--api-key: Each request must include anx-api-keyheader with a valid Crypto APIs key. This enables hosting a public server where each user provides their own key.
# Per-request key mode (multi-tenant)
npx @cryptoapis-io/mcp-simulate --transport http --port 3000
# Clients send x-api-key header with each request
Stdio transport always requires an API key at startup.

Remote MCP Server
Crypto APIs provides an official remote MCP server with all tools available via HTTP Streamable transport at https://ai.cryptoapis.io/mcp. Pass your API key via the x-api-key header — no installation required.
